Tianeptine and Depression: Current Evidence

The use of tianeptine in the therapy of depressive illness remains a controversial topic. Initially introduced as an antidepressant in some countries, the drug's function appears to be different from traditional selective serotonin reuptake inhibitors (SSRIs) – seemingly enhancing serotonin secretion and decreasing its absorption, while also influencing glutamate networks. Clinical research have shown inconsistent results; while some indicate effectiveness in alleviating manifestations of depression, particularly in people who haven't benefited adequately to other medications, others have shown limited success. Furthermore, the increasing reports of withdrawal syndrome and potential for habituation have raised significant questions regarding its sustained well-being and appropriate use. Consequently, current guidelines often restrict its recommendation and emphasize the need for careful monitoring and individual awareness when it is evaluated.

Tianeptine Sulfate Withdrawal Condition: Symptoms and Management

Discontinuing tianeptine use, particularly after prolonged or high-dose administration, can trigger a complex withdrawal syndrome characterized by a range of bodily and mental signs. Initial responses may include gastrointestinal distress, such as nausea, loose stools, and stomach pain. Brain-related symptoms can emerge as headaches, difficulty sleeping, and nervousness. More intensely affected individuals may experience depression, depressive thoughts, shaking, and in rare instances, seizures. Coping of tianeptine withdrawal necessitates a gradual tapering schedule, ideally under the monitoring of a clinical expert. Comforting care, including hydration, alimentary assistance, and psychological counseling, is crucial to promote a safe and successful recovery. Pharmaceuticals may be prescribed to treat specific withdrawal symptoms, but the focus should always remain on a organized and monitored diminishment in tianeptine dosage.
